Price City Council approved the city’s final fiscal 2025–26 budget and a separate year‑end budget revision after public hearings. The council adopted Resolution Number 2025‑18 (final budget for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2026) and Resolution Number 2025‑16 (amending the revised budget for fiscal 2024–25) by unanimous voice votes.

During a separate enterprise fund transfer public hearing, city staff explained that the electric fund’s proposed transfer to the general fund for the coming year is $3,300,000, representing about 30% of the electric fund’s budgeted expenditures ($11,023,800).
